Turner & Townsend is a global professional services company with over 22,000 people in more than 60 countries.
Working with our clients across real estate, infrastructure, energy and natural resources, we transform together delivering outcomes that improve people’s lives. Working in partnership makes it possible to deliver the world’s most impactful projects and programmes as we turn challenge into opportunity and complexity into success.
Our capabilities include programme, project, cost, asset and commercial management, controls and performance, procurement and supply chain, net zero and digital solutions.
We are majority-owned by CBRE Group, Inc., the world’s largest commercial real estate services and investment firm, with our partners holding a significant minority interest. Turner & Townsend and CBRE work together to provide clients with the premier programme, project and cost management offering in markets around the world.

MAIN PURPOSE OF ROLE

  • To lead Project Management Commissions, taking responsibility for end to end service delivery, often with respect to large or complex projects.
  • To act as the key, day to day client interface, ensuring that client objectives are met and that projects are delivered to time and cost targets and the appropriate quality standards.
  • SCOPE

    Senior Project Managers handle commissions of varying sizes, depending upon the complexity of the project, etc. Typically, projects fall within the £10m to £25m range. However, where the service provided is advisory in nature, for example advising on urban re-generation funding, the overall project size may be much larger.

    K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ES

    Project management, to include:

  • Advising at a strategic level at the project inception stage, including providing advice on the different approaches that can be adopted in order to successfully achieve the client’s overall objectives
  • Preparing and maintaining definitions of project requirements
  • Helping to establish the overall success criteria for the project, including time, cost, technical and performance parameters
  • Establishing effective project governance, processes and systems to be utilised throughout project
  • Preparing and maintaining schedules of activity, including producing the master project plan
  • Managing the development of the project in accordance with approved plans and targets
  • Developing and implementing resource plans and procurement of resources
  • Leading and facilitating the overall cross-functional project team
  • Monitoring and applying performance management techniques, including the use of KPI’s to improve project performance
  • Managing the change control process
  • Developing and agreeing budgets and controlling forecast and actual costs against them
  • Managing the flow of project information between the team and the client, through regular meetings and written communications
  • Identifying and monitoring project risks and planning and implementing risk mitigations
  • Preparing formal project progress and other reports
  • Taking a leading role in interfacing with the client, other consultants, and managing stakeholders at all project stages
  • Advising the client regarding Health & Safety and Environmental issues and risks
  • Planning for and the ongoing management of quality, safety, health and environment issues

    KEY PERFORMANCE INDICATORS

    A Senior Project Manager will in part be judged by the extent to which:

  • Projects are managed to the right quality standards and are completed efficiently, on time and to budget
  • Project delivery meets the client’s objectives and is in line with the conditions of appointment
  • The project team is led effectively
  • Strong relationships are developed with clients and members of the cross-functional team
  • General line management responsibilities (where appropriate) are effectively discharged
  • Business development opportunities with existing and new clients, including cross- selling opportunities, are identified and acted upon
  • The internal financial status of all projects is effectively monitored
  • Key information and data is effectively cascaded and appropriately retained
